Job vacancy Accountant
Accountant
· Provide support on annual program budget development and create cost libraries to advise program budgets
· Sound understanding and monitoring of annual and monthly budget
· Monitor monthly expenditure against overall budget, ensure expenses to be incurred are allowable, allocable and reasonable and advise accordingly
· Preparation of timely monthly / quarterly management accounts and dissemination to relevant stakeholders by the 15th of following month/ quarter
· Maintain monthly follow up register and flag outstanding actions
· Monthly Accounting Activity
· Maintain updated and accurate books in the organization’s ERP system (Microsoft Dynamics 365)
· Ensure accurate data entry in relation to amount and account allocation, and any other dimensions as per the accounting standards of the program and GAAP
· Prepare accurate bank reconciliations for project bank accounts and deal with reconciling items conclusively
· Prepare accurate cash reconciliations for project account
· Ensure complete copies of original documents sent to donor are properly file / maintained
· Undertake periodic visits to project sites for compliance and supportive supervision
· Undertake monthly reconciliation of all payroll liabilities, payables and receivables
· Ensure Fixed Assets register is accurately maintained and updated monthly
· Timely communication with stakeholders (including management) on pertinent financial matters as they arise for programs in your docket
· Keep track of grant management actions such as renewal of Agreements/ Modifications and keep senior management and staff updated of the status
· Attend relevant workshops and present on financial issues where required
· Ensure adherence to the financial policies and procedures, donor and statutory requirements for programs in your docket
· Take a leading role in coordination of financial aspects to support smooth program close - out
· including timely communication to stakeholders and close adherence to internal timelines
· Authorize internal purchase requisitions to indicate that sufficient funds are available and relevantly allocated in the budget
· Authorize cheque, online and cash payments by approving the payment voucher after verifying that the payment is adequately supported
· Maintain up to date donor registers and disseminate to relevant stakeholders highlighting changes whenever there is a change

Key Requirements Skills, experience and qualification
· Bachelor’s degree in accounting or related field
· Specialized Training/Professional Qualifications
· CPA Part II (Intermediate Level II) or equivalent successfully completed
· Competencies/Abilities/Skills Required
· Excellent computer skills, including proficiency in MS- Office, particularly Excel
· Proficient knowledge of one or more accounting packages
· Knowledge of ERP systems is an added advantage
· Good communication and presentation skills
· Good analytical skills – strong attention to detail and investigative nature.
· Well-developed interpersonal skills and experience developing staff by assessing development needs, coaching and delivering training
· Strong work ethic and ability and willingness to work a flexible schedule
· Stable to work in team settings and willingness to learn
· Ability to multitask and work under minimal supervision, while meeting strict deadlines
· Good planning and coordination skills
· Strong auditing skills
